In this highly stylized Brazilian drama a sax player fondly remembers one wonderful night spent with his life's love and decides to find her again. He embarks upon a quest through the wild streets of Rio to find her. Along the way he meets an assortment of odd urban underworld characters.
In Nilópolis, Eliane, a 15-year-old girl, who is the daughter of a lower-middle-class couple, falls in love with Otávio, a 33-year-old divorcee. Upon learning of the relationship, Eliane's parents forbid her to meet her lover.
Tânia Izabel Pérsia de Boscoli (São Paulo, January 22, 1963) is a Brazilian actress, dancer and director. She is the daughter of actress Myriam Pérsia.
